Who is Jean Seaton?
Jean Seaton is Professor of media history at the University of Westminster.
She is the official historian of the BBC, who is continuing Asa Briggs' multi-volume account of the Corporation's history with the next volume The BBC Under Siege in preparation. Her other books include Power Without Responsibility now in its seventh edition. Seaton was first Chair of the judges of the Orwell Prize in 2007, a role she retains.
Jean Seaton is the widow of the historian Ben Pimlott whom she married in 1977; the couple had three children.
